当前位置: 首页 > 网络应用技术

如何添加样式文件django(2023年最新共享)

时间:2023-03-06 19:24:41 网络应用技术

  简介:许多朋友询问了Django如何加入样式文件。本文的首席CTO笔记将为您提供详细的答案,以供所有人参考。我希望这对每个人都会有所帮助!让我们一起看看!

  像普通的HTML一样,但是使用Django的父亲和儿子模板,整个站,模块和第三页的CSS文件是更好的布局。

  参考如下

  如果该项目的目录是:

  我的网站:

  manage.py

  我的网站:

  __init__.py settings.py urls.py wsgi.py

  博客(已建立的应用程序):

  models.py views.py test.py __init__.py模板

  开始配置:

  1.在外部MySite目录中(即项目的根目录)

  2.打开设置。py并添加:

  导入操作系统

  static_url ='/static/'

  staticfiles_dirs =(

  

  (((((

  3.打开urls.py并添加(注意:如果在博客应用程序中新创建一个urls.py文件,则应将其添加到博客目录中的urls.py文件中。我曾经在此PIT中纠结许久):

  导入设置

  urlpatterns =模式(

  url(r'^static/(?ppath。*)$','django.views.static.serve',

  {'document_root':settings.static_root}),

  治愈

  使用:

  假设在模板中导入外部/home/fudaoji/mysite/js/jequery.js文件(存储在模板文件中),那么您可以直接直接可以直接为

  脚本类型=“ text/javascript” src ='https://www.shouxicto.com/stative/js/jqury.js'/javascript

  您好,建议。在使用静态文件的每个模板中,都必须添加'{%加载staticfiles%}`。我想我只将其添加到base.html中,而index.html在不添加的情况下继承了它。

  在模板的HTML文件的头部或新页面(HTML)(您可以报价模板或不使用它)中引入CSS样式,在新页面的头部介绍CSS样式。

  简而言之,这与您的普通HTML网页介绍CSS样式是相同的方式

  如果您也处于这种情况下,可以通过以下方案解决90%的问题,

  在浏览器中打开Django随附的背景管理员,发现浏览器成功的响应是成功的,但是丢失了样式。

  不用担心,Winl+R(Win Key是键盘左下角的第二个键)打开输入regedit以打开您的注册表,

  然后找到hkey_classses_root -.css(前面有一个点...)然后单击它,然后选择内容类型

  文本/CSS内容更改的初始内容是应用程序/X-CSS,因此丢失了样式。更改后

  刷新浏览器+重新启动Django服务器,您想要的样式将恢复,

  您可以将其转移给您的专业测试

  config.yaml ----名称:chedushi版本:1个库:-NAME:django版本:“ 1.4”处理程序:-url: /static static_dir:静态以将样式和资源文件放在root Directory的上述目录上

  结论:以上是首席CTO注释向您介绍Django的全部内容。我希望这对每个人都会有所帮助。如果您想了解更多有关此信息的信息,请记住收集并关注此网站。